Why GRP is better than Plastic

Fiberglass has always been a great alternative for molding different types of products. Because of its strength, durability, ability to withstand high temperatures, and acidity-alkalinity,
Uses includes : Body parts of Cars and eve racing Cars due to its light weight and Strength, Truck parts etc as with the luxury finishes in Yachts and boats as well.
Properties :
Non rusty,
Lightweight but strong and more durable than regular plastic.
Heat & cold resistant
High corrosion resistant
Able to withstand various types of chemicals depending on properly selected types of resin
Long service life
High formability and various colors to choose
Lower cost
Difference between conventional Plastics and Fiberglass :
Thermoplastic (general plastics) often changes with temperature. When heated, it begins to melt, and it freezes up again when it’s cold. This frequent change of condition reflects its lack of durability.
In contrast, the Thermosetting (fiberglass) will remain stable and does not change its shape, however hot or cold it gets. Moreover, the resin used in manufacturing fiberglass also contains UV resistance properties. This will prevent UV in sunlight from destroying the molecular structure of fiberglass products or causing them to decay and fade too quickly. Thus, the service life of the product is extended.
